Senior Global Field Representative Company: The Boeing Company The Boeing Company is seeking highly motivated and skilled Senior Global Field Representatives to join our Global Field Operations (GFO) team. Global Field Operations (GFO) is building an elite organization with technical expertise and skills to triage, recover, and sustain our supply chain. This team is deployed to supplier challenges to restore production stability, recover delivery performance, eliminate systemic constraints, and protect Boeing customer commitments. The Global Field Representatives serve as Boeing's on-site operational leaders, partnering directly with supplier executives, factory leadership, and Boeing stakeholders to drive sustainable operational improvements across manufacturing, planning, quality, and supply chain systems. Assignments may include major aerostructures, interiors, systems, machining, composites, sheet metal fabrication, special processing, and multi-tier supply chain recovery efforts. Successful candidates thrive in complex manufacturing environments, possess deep shop-floor credibility, and demonstrate exceptional leadership, problem-solving, and execution skills. Position Responsibilities: Lead supplier recovery engagements at strategic manufacturing and supply chain locations. Conduct Gemba-based assessments of manufacturing operations, production systems, labor utilization, inventory health, material flow, capacity, and schedule performance. Develop and execute actionable recovery plans focused on throughput, delivery performance, quality, and operational stability. Drive demand alignment between Boeing requirements and supplier execution plans. Lead Root Cause Corrective Action (RCCA) activities and ensure sustainable corrective actions are implemented. Establish daily management systems, KPI reviews, accountability mechanisms, and recovery governance structures. Partner directly with supplier executives, factory leadership, and Boeing stakeholders to remove barriers to execution. Support work transfers, capacity expansion, surge activities, and operational transformations. Develop supplier capability through coaching, mentoring, and implementation of best practices. Provide executive-level communication regarding recovery status, risks, constraints, and recommendations. Demonstrate strong leadership by influence, cross-functional collaboration, and a bias for execution in high-pressure environments. This position is expected to be 100% onsite.
